Job Summary
The Bartender at Limelight Hotels by Aspen One mixes and serves beverages in a timely and friendly manner. They also oversee the security of liquor, checks, and cash, and participate in the physical setup and breakdown of the bar. This position reports to the Restaurant Manager.
Essential Job Functions/Key Responsibilities
- Offer guests recommendations of drinks to compliment certain food items
- Know all menu item origins, preparations, and ingredients to make recommendations
- Mix drinks and serve alcoholic and nonalcoholic beverages
- Complete beverage and general supply requisitions
- Ensure guests satisfaction and inform management of guest’s comments and complaints
- Monitor guests who are over intoxicated and communicate sightings to management team for further evaluation
- Assist in emergency and security procedures as directed by management and the established emergency plan
- Reset area, clean all indoor and outdoor areas and perform side duties assigned by the Manager
- Absorb and organize kitchen items, to include, dry goods, kitchen equipment, storage containers, cleaning supplies and proper rotation and organization of all F&B deliveries
- Complete tasks and projects delegated by your manager and assist other departments as business volumes and staff levels demand
- Enforce and comply with all policies and procedures for the Food and Beverage department
Qualifications
- High School Diploma or equivalent required
- Must be over 18 years of age
- TIPS trained
- Six months to one year of related experience preferred
- Proficient knowledge in all wines by the glass
- Basic knowledge of alcoholic beverages and cocktail creation methods preferred
- Knowledge in cash and credit card payment processing
- Knowledge of local attractions, restaurants and activities
- Mixology Skills
- Ability to wet up, maintain, and break down bar area
- Ability to work outdoors
- Ability to maintain a positive, professional, team-player attitude
- Ability to work outdoors at high elevation for entire shift
- Ability to maintain the proper care and cleanliness of serving equipment and glassware
- Ability to serve guests in a timely and friendly manner
